Podcast solutions : the complete guide to podcasting

Are you the kind of person who's got a lot to say? Have you ever wanted to share your talents, thoughts, and opinions with others, but have lacked the broadcasting knowledge and contacts to achieve such a goal? Well, today it's well within your grasp, thanks to Podcasting. Using only some simple recording equipment, a computer, and the Internet, you can record and distribute your own audio shows, including anything you want -- comedy, debate, news, reviews, interviews, music -- the only limit is your imagination. Of course, you'll need a guide to tell you what you need to know, which is where this indispensable book comes in. This book is a shrewd and comprehensive guide to podcasting. From downloading podcasts to producing your own for fun or profit, it covers the entire world of podcasting with insight, humor, and the unmatched wisdom of experience. You'll learn: How to receive podcasts; How podcasting is being applied in many different industries; How to plan and design your own top quality podcast, including expert advice on designing a show built for success; How to set up your "podcast studio," whether you're a casual hobbyist or a committed professional. Includes insights and buying advice on finding the right microphones, mixers, software, hardware, and more to meet your needs and fit your budget; The secrets to achieving "broadcast quality" audio for your show; How to include music, phone calls and audio feedback into your podcast inexpensively and legally; The techniques needed to turn your podcasts into Internet-ready audio files and get them out there ready to be received by your anxiously-waiting listeners, using simple hardware and software tools; The meaning of RSS, XML, mp3, LAME, and several other acronyms you thought you'd never understand; Insider's tips on creating a web presence that will enhance the popularity and professionalism of your show; Secrets of attracting listeners through the creative use of directories, user groups, mailing lists and more; How to make money with your podcast by attracting sponsors, advertisers, and other revenue sources.

  • "Welcome to Podcast Solutions: The Complete Guide to Podcasting, Second Edition. We had a simple goal in mind while we wrote this book: to give you a straightforward overview of p- casting and share the information necessary to get you up and running with a quality podcast. Within the pages of this book, you'll find everything you need to know to get started in p- casting. We'll cover the history of podcasting, how to download podcasts, and, most important, how to produce and distribute your own podcast. We're not geeks, and this isn't a geek book. There's no way to detail step-by-step instructions for every piece of software that conceivably exists for podcasting, and we're not going to try to impress you with an exhaustive (and therefore exhausting) list of every website that has a- thing to do with podcasting (that's what Google is for). Things are moving so quickly in p- casting that it seems every day brings a new product or service announcement. If we covered them all, you'd never make it to the end of the book, and you'd never begin doing the one thing we really want to help you do: start making your own podcasts. Instead, we've used our c- bined experience to carefully select and detail the software, hardware, and services we feel stand out and deserve mention for helping people get started in podcasting. While we're at it, we don't think you're a "dummy. " Podcasting isn't for dummies."
